NVIDIA shares trade near $224 following robust fiscal Q2 2027 results that delivered $96.2 billion in revenue, up 106% year-over-year, with data-center sales reaching $89 billion. Management guided fiscal 2028 revenue growth of approximately 70%, exceeding analyst models, supported by hyperscaler capital expenditure commitments projected at $800 billion in 2026 and $1.3 trillion in 2027, plus expanded AWS GPU deployments. Supply constraints and memory costs remain key variables, while the stock’s forward multiple hovers near 26 times earnings amid broader AI infrastructure spending trends. Trader consensus on Polymarket for end-of-September closes above near-term thresholds incorporates these fundamentals alongside potential volatility from macroeconomic data and sector rotation.

If the two specified prices are exactly equal, this market will resolve to "No".
Closing prices will be used exactly as published by Pyth, without rounding.
If NVIDIA (NVDA) does not trade at all during the regular session of the final trading day of the month, the market will resolve 50-50.
For a standard full trading session, the closing price refers to the Pyth "Close" value of the 1-minute candle corresponding to the final minute of regular trading hours on the primary exchange. If the relevant session is shortened (for example, due to a market-holiday schedule), the Pyth "Close" value of the 1-minute candle corresponding to the final minute of that shortened session will be used.
If the relevant day has no valid Pyth Close value for the 1-minute candle corresponding to the end of regular trading hours on the primary exchange, the market will use the last valid Pyth price achieved during the regular trading hours of the primary exchange as the effective closing price. If no valid Pyth price exists for that trading day due to a system outage, data failure, or other technical disruption, the official closing price published by the primary exchange on which the listed security trades will be used to determine the closing price for that day.
In the event of a stock split, reverse stock split, or similar corporate action affecting the listed security during the listed time frame, this market will resolve based on split-adjusted prices as displayed on Pyth. The target price will be adjusted proportionally to reflect any stock splits. Resolution will be based on the historical price data as shown on Pyth after any adjustments have been applied.
The resolution source for this market will be Pyth, specifically the "Close" values for the relevant 1-minute candle for NVIDIA (NVDA) available at https://pythdata.app/explore/Equity.US.NVDA%2FUSD.
